-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i, I am try to Write Firmware into the SPI Flash "S25FL127SABMFI101". Write is Successful but unable to boot the Firmware .
I able to erase and read SPI flash.
So, Guide me what is the issue??
Flashing from Control center is successfully boot the Firmware.
I am using the "USBspiDMA " example code.
And attach me Application Code.
Solved! Go to Solution.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ello,
Based on my understanding, you are able to download the firmware into SPI flash and boot properly when control center application is used. But, when you use your own application, you are able to write the firmware to the flash but not able to boot it properly. Please correct me if my understanding is wrong.
If my understanding is correct, then please try the following:
1. Write the firmware using the application into the flash
2. Read back the complete firmware from the flash by adding required code in the application
3. Compare the image file with the data received from the flash
Please check if the data in the image file and the data read from the flash are same or not. If not, then please check where the mismatch occurs. This can be used to debug the problem.
Jayakrishna
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hello,
Based on my understanding, you are able to download the firmware into SPI flash and boot properly when control center application is used. But, when you use your own application, you are able to write the firmware to the flash but not able to boot it properly. Please correct me if my understanding is wrong.
If my understanding is correct, then please try the following:
1. Write the firmware using the application into the flash
2. Read back the complete firmware from the flash by adding required code in the application
3. Compare the image file with the data received from the flash
Please check if the data in the image file and the data read from the flash are same or not. If not, then please check where the mismatch occurs. This can be used to debug the problem.
Jayakrishna